Watch: iPhone X Facial ID fooled within week of launch by 10-year old boy

Cybersecurity researchers have found an ingenious way to fool Apple’s Face ID just a week after the launch of the iPhone X.

More embarrassing still for the tech giant, a 10-year old boy has found a way round the security check.

Replacing Touch ID, Face ID makes authentication more convenient for users who only have to look at their phone.

The new feature uses infrared light to map users’ faces and unlock the phone when the owner’s face hoves into view.
